    Originally posted by kbaumen
    15)White to move. +-

    [fen]rnb3kr/ppp2ppp/1b6/3q4/3pN3/Q4N2/PPP2KPP/R1B1R3 w[/fen]
    Nf6+, gxf6
    Qf8+, Kxf8
    Bh6+, Kg8
    Re8#

    Originally posted by kbaumen
    12)White to move. +-

    [fen]6k1/pp3ppp/2b1p3/2Q1P1P1/3rq3/5R2/P4R1P/6K1[/fen]
    Totally of the top of my head, here goes;
    1. Qf8+! Kxf8
    2. Rxf7+ Kg8
    3. Rf8#
    or:
    1. Qf8+! Kxf8
    2. Rxf7+ Ke8
    3. Rf8+ Ke7/Kd7
    4. R(f2)f7#
